The Impact of Rising Electricity Costs on American Households and Businesses

The recent surge in electricity costs is creating a ripple effect across American households and businesses, leading to significant financial strain. Many families are finding that they must choose between essential needs, such as food and healthcare, or keeping the lights on. The increase in utility bills has added an unwelcome burden on budgets already stretched thin by inflation and other rising costs. A recent survey revealed that:

  • 40% of respondents reported cutting back on expenses.
  • 30% said they have started using less electricity to avoid higher bills.
  • 25% have switched to cheaper, less efficient appliances.

Businesses, particularly small enterprises, are feeling the sting of these rising costs as well. Higher electricity bills can lead to reduced profit margins and may force business owners to consider layoffs or passing these costs on to consumers. Many are scrambling to find immediate solutions, such as investing in energy-efficient technologies or alternative energy sources. According to data garnered from a recent industry report:

Business Size Impact of Rising Costs
Small Businesses Significant profit margin reduction
Medium Enterprises Operational adjustments required
Large Corporations Long-term strategy shifts

Assessing the Political Fallout from Increasing Energy Prices

The surge in electricity prices across the United States has begun to reshape the political landscape as constituents express growing frustration over affordability and economic stability. As energy bills climb, voters are increasingly holding their elected officials accountable, leading to a significant uptick in calls for legislative action. Key issues emerging from this crisis include:

  • Rising inflation concerns linked to energy costs
  • A bipartisan backlash against utility companies
  • Calls for increased investment in renewable sources

This situation has created a pivotal moment for political leaders, who find themselves at a crossroads between addressing immediate electoral concerns and pursuing long-term energy policies. As the impacts of rising electricity costs affect households, particularly in low-income and rural areas, officials are being pressured to propose tangible solutions. Proposed measures include:

  • Subsidies for vulnerable populations
  • Incentives for energy efficiency and conservation programs
  • Proposals for a cap on energy price hikes
State % Increase in Electricity Prices
California 12%
Texas 15%
Florida 10%
New York 8%

Strategic Recommendations for Policy Makers to Alleviate Burden on Consumers

To mitigate the financial strain on consumers facing skyrocketing electricity costs, policy makers must adopt a multi-faceted approach that prioritizes both immediate relief and long-term sustainability. Subsidizing renewable energy sources, including solar and wind, can significantly lower dependency on costly fossil fuels while promoting green technology. By investing in energy efficiency programs that incentivize retrofitting homes and businesses, authorities can help consumers reduce their overall energy consumption. Furthermore, extending financial assistance to low-income households for utility bills would provide a crucial buffer against rising costs.

Additionally, regulatory frameworks should be revisited to enhance transparency and competition in energy markets. Implementing measures that promote fair pricing and prevent monopolistic behaviors will encourage more competitive rates for consumers. Policy makers can also seek to establish community energy programs that allow localities to generate and manage their own energy resources, thus reducing reliance on external suppliers. Creating a balanced energy policy that combines affordability, sustainability, and equity will ultimately empower consumers while transitioning to a cleaner, more reliable energy system.
